MainDuties & Responsibilities Summary/Objective
The Senior Maintenance Mechanic is responsible for maintaining and improving the reliability of CNC production equipment, including Swiss lathes and related systems, by performing advanced troubleshooting, repairs, and preventive maintenance. This role operates with a high level of independence, leads complex diagnostics across m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ic systems, and ensures accurate work order documentation while supporting safe, efficient shop operations.
This shift is for 1st (Friday through Sunday: 6:00am to 6:30pm).
- Perform preventive maintenance (PM) on CNC production equipment, including Swiss lathes and supporting systems, and ensure PM completion aligns with production and maintenance schedules.
- Respond to equipment issues during production and independently diagnose, troubleshoot, and repair m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ic systems.
- Lead root cause analysis of equipment failures and implement corrective actions to reduce recurring downtime.
- Create, update, and close work orders in the maintenance system, ensuring detailed and accurate documentation of work performed, parts used, downtime causes, and corrective actions.
- Read and interpret equipment manuals, electrical schematics, and technical documents to perform advanced maintenance and repairs.
- Support and guide junior maintenance personnel by providing technical direction and assistance in troubleshooting and repair activities.
- Coordinate with production and leadership to prioritize maintenance activities based on equipment criticality and production impact.
- Assist with equipment setup, adjustments, installations, and process improvements to support production efficiency.
- Follow and enforce all safety procedures, including lockout/tagout (LOTO), and ensure equipment is in a safe condition prior to returning to service.
- Maintain organization of tools, parts, and work areas, and support identification and management of critical spare parts and maintenance inventory.
- Drive continuous improvement efforts by identifying trends in equipment performance and recommending process or maintenance improvements.

Work EnvironmentWork is performed in a CNC machine shop environment with exposure to high noise levels, moving mechanical equipment, temperature fluctuations, and metalworking processes. The role regularly involves working around production machinery including CNC machines, bar feeders, conveyors, coolant systems, and related equipment.
Potential hazards include exposure to moving mechanical parts, sharp edges, hot surfaces, metal chips, metalworking fluids, and airborne particulates. Hazards include cuts, burns, strains, and pinch points. App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) such as safety glasses, hearing protection, and protective clothing is required.
